/*
@test
@bug 6562853
@summary Tests that focus transfered directy to window w/o transfering it to frame.
@author Oleg Sukhodolsky: area=awt.focus
@library ../../regtesthelpers
@build Util
@run main TranserFocusToWindow
*/
import java.awt.Button;
import java.awt.Component;
import java.awt.Frame;
import java.awt.Robot;
import java.awt.Window;
import java.awt.event.WindowEvent;
import java.awt.event.WindowFocusListener;
import test.java.awt.regtesthelpers.Util;
public class TranserFocusToWindow
{
public static void main(String[] args) {
Robot robot = Util.createRobot();
Frame owner_frame = new Frame("Owner frame");
owner_frame.setBounds(0, 0, 200, 200);
owner_frame.setVisible(true);
Util.waitForIdle(robot);
Window window = new Window(owner_frame);
Button btn1 = new Button("button for focus");
window.add(btn1);
window.pack();
window.setLocation(0, 300);
window.setVisible(true);
Util.waitForIdle(robot);
Frame another_frame = new Frame("Another frame");
Button btn2 = new Button("button in a frame");
another_frame.add(btn2);
another_frame.pack();
another_frame.setLocation(300, 0);
another_frame.setVisible(true);
Util.waitForIdle(robot);
Util.clickOnTitle(owner_frame, robot);
Util.waitForIdle(robot);
setFocus(btn1, robot);
setFocus(btn2, robot);
owner_frame.addWindowFocusListener(new WindowFocusListener() {
public void windowLostFocus(WindowEvent we) {
System.out.println(we);
}
public void windowGainedFocus(WindowEvent we) {
System.out.println(we);
throw new RuntimeException("owner frame must not receive WINDWO_GAINED_FOCUS");
}
});
window.addWindowFocusListener(new WindowFocusListener() {
public void windowLostFocus(WindowEvent we) {
System.out.println(we);
}
public void windowGainedFocus(WindowEvent we) {
System.out.println(we);
}
});
another_frame.addWindowFocusListener(new WindowFocusListener() {
public void windowLostFocus(WindowEvent we) {
System.out.println(we);
}
public void windowGainedFocus(WindowEvent we) {
System.out.println(we);
}
});
// we need this delay so WM can not treat two clicks on title as double click
robot.delay(500);
Util.clickOnTitle(owner_frame, robot);
Util.waitForIdle(robot);
System.out.println("test passed");
}
private static void setFocus(final Component comp, final Robot r) {
if (comp.hasFocus()) {
return;
}
Util.clickOnComp(comp, r);
Util.waitForIdle(r);
if (!comp.hasFocus()) {
throw new RuntimeException("can not set focus on " + comp);
}
}
}
